Abstract
The utility model discloses a kind of folding beds, upper enclosure frame component including support base and set on the support base top, the support base includes two supporting legs for being divided into the left and right sides, and it is detachably connected to the stull component between supporting leg described in two sides, the stull component is located at the lower section of the upper enclosure frame component, the upper enclosure frame component includes at least two upper poles for being divided into the left and right sides, two upper poles respectively extend along the longitudinal direction, and the top of the supporting leg is pivotally connected on the upper pole around the axial line of the upper pole.The folding bed is with good stability in the deployed state, when needing to be folded, it only needs to disassemble the lower enclosure frame component as stull component, then the supporting leg of two sides is overturn can complete in opposite directions with respect to upper enclosure frame component, folding operation is very simple and very flat structure is presented after folding, and provides a great convenience for daily storage and the carrying etc. of user.

Specific embodiment
The technical solution of the utility model is further elaborated in the following with reference to the drawings and specific embodiments.
Referring to Fig. 1, folding bed shown in Fig. 3 comprising support base and the upper enclosure frame component set on the support base top
200, support base include be divided into the left and right sides two supporting legs 100, and be detachably connected to leg 100 supported on both sides it
Between stull component 300, stull component 300 is located at the lower section of upper enclosure frame component 200.Wherein, upper enclosure frame component 200 includes at least
Two upper poles of the left and right sides are divided into, this two upper poles respectively extend along the longitudinal direction;On every side of folding bed, branch
The top of support leg 100 is pivotally connected on upper pole around the axial line of above-mentioned upper pole.
The folding bed have opening state and folded state, when the folding bed in the open state, such as Fig. 1, Fig. 3 institute
Show, ground is stood in the support of supporting leg 100 of two sides, and both upper enclosure frame component 200 and stull component 300 are supported on one on the other
Between the supporting leg 100 of two sides;When the folding bed is in folded state, as shown in Figure 4, Figure 5, stull component 300 is from two
It is separated between supporting leg 100, the supporting leg 100 of two sides is overturn in opposite directions rotating around the upper pole of corresponding side, and is collapsed in upper enclosure frame
The same side of component 200, in flat structure.
Specifically, referring to shown in Fig. 1 to 5, the supporting leg 100 of every side includes the column 1 vertically extended and consolidates
Set on 1 bottom of column and it is used to support bottom bar 2 on the ground, column 1 includes can along the vertical direction with respect to sliding extension
The upper supporting leg 11 of connection and lower supporting leg 12, the bottom of bottom bar 2 from lower supporting leg 12 forwardly and/or backwardly extends.In the present embodiment,
Bottom bar 2 extends from the bottom of lower supporting leg 12 towards side along the longitudinal direction so that L-shaped between bottom bar 2 and column 1.The bottom bar 2 packet
The first bottom bar 21 and the second bottom bar 22 of relative telescopic setting along the longitudinal direction are included, wherein the end of the first bottom bar 21 and lower supporting leg
12 bottom end is permanently connected or the first bottom bar 21 is wholely set with lower supporting leg 12.
Referring to shown in Fig. 1, Fig. 3, stull component 300 is set between the column 1 of two sides, is herein setting in two sides upper supporting leg
Between 11 lower part, it is lower enclosure frame component which uses herein, which can be used as folding bed
The Auxiliary support of upper bed board.The lower enclosure frame component includes U-shaped lower frame body 8 and is circumferentially in the support frame 9 for closing frame-type, under
Framework 8 has the lower railing 81 for being divided into the left and right sides and is connected to the lower lateral rods 82 under two sides between 81 one end of railing, supports
Frame 9 is fixedly set under two sides between railing 81.The other end of railing 81 forms connection-peg 81a under two sides, respectively with two
It is detachably connected between the upper supporting leg 11 of side.
Shown in Figure 1, the upper supporting leg 11 of column 1 is equipped with grafting bushing 11a, the grafting bushing on two sides upper supporting leg 11
11a is oppositely arranged;Pass through the two connection-peg 81a and above-mentioned two grafting bushing on railing 81 under two sides in lower enclosure frame component
Mating between 11a, to realize plug connection between the two.
Referring to figs. 1 to 5, upper enclosure frame component 200 includes enclosing to set along axial direction to enclose in the first peripheral frame 4 of peripheral frame with second
Frame 5, the first peripheral frame 4 and the second peripheral frame 5 are U-shaped herein, and the first peripheral frame 4 includes that two first at left and right sides of being divided into enclose
Bar 41 and the first side lever 42 being connected between two first railings 41;Second peripheral frame 5 includes two for being divided into the left and right sides
Second railing 51 and the second side lever 52 being connected between two second railings 51, the first railing 41 on the same side are enclosed with second
Bar 51 is connected and forms upper pole, and the top of supporting leg 100 is connected in 51 the two of the first upper pole 41 and the second railing
One of on.
Referring to shown in Fig. 1, Fig. 2, the top of every heel post 1 is fixedly provided with peripheral frame connector 3,3 energy of peripheral frame connector
Enough axial lines around upper pole are rotatably set on upper pole, and in the present embodiment, peripheral frame connector 3 is connected to the first railing 41
On.Specifically, there is the cannula portion 31 being set on upper pole, the cannula portion 31 is around the first railing 41 on the peripheral frame connector 3
Axial line be rotatably set on the first railing 41.As shown in Fig. 2, being also provided with limit circumferentially in cannula portion 31
Slot 33 has been fixedly disposed spacer pin 6 on first railing 41, which opposite can be plugged in above-mentioned limit in which be slidably matched
In the slot 33 of position, to provide the guiding and limit of the two relative rotation when supporting leg 100 is rotated around upper pole.
When the folding bed in the open state, spacer pin 6 is kept out on one end cell wall of limiting slot 33, by that will enclose down
Frame component 300 is connected between the column 1 of two sides, can make it is relatively fixed between the first railing 41 and peripheral frame connector 3, from
And under making with respect to two supporting legs 100 of upper enclosure frame component 200 fixed and keeping folding bed steadily in the open state;When will under
Peripheral frame component 300 between two heel posts 1 after separating, by leg 100 supported on both sides respectively with respect to the axis of the first railing of respective side 41
When heart line rotates, spacer pin 6 relatively slides in limiting slot 33 until it is kept out to the other end cell wall of limiting slot 33, support
Leg 100 is collapsed with upper enclosure frame component 200, realizes the folding of folding bed.
Referring to shown in Fig. 6 to Figure 11, on the upper enclosure frame component 200 of the present embodiment, edge is equipped in the rod cavity of the first railing 41
The slide bar 43 of its length extending direction sliding, is installed with connecting rod 53 on the second railing 51, the end of connecting rod 53 passes through rotation
Axis 7 is connect with the end phase pivot of slide bar 43.This make folding bed in the open state under when, upper enclosure frame component 200 have two
A working condition: when upper enclosure frame component 200 is in the first working condition, 51 edge of the first railing 41 and the second railing of the same side
Same length direction extends, and slide bar 43, rotation axis 7 and connecting rod 53 are contained in the rod cavity of the first railing 41, such as Fig. 1, figure
2, shown in Fig. 6;When upper enclosure frame component 200 is in the second working condition, at least part of slide bar 43 is stretched from the first railing 41
Out, so that connecting rod 53 and rotation axis 7 are respectively positioned on outside the rod cavity of the first railing 41, as shown in Figure 7, Figure 8, the second railing 51 at this time
It can be downwardly turned over respect to the first railing 41 and shape has angle between the first railing 41, as shown in Figures 9 to 11.It sets in this way
The major advantage set is that it is possible to reduce the height at the second peripheral frame 5, and the infant on folding bed is looked after convenient for adult.
